While there are technical and geographical constraints for certain technologies, three technologies suitable for implementation in Ireland are battery storage in the short term, pumped storage hydro in the medium to long term and hydrogen storage in the long term. Irish grid operator EirGrid set the proposed minimum procurement for long duration energy storage procurement at 201 MW, well below its initial 2030 goal of 500 MW of storage capacity. Energy Storage Ireland called for more ambition and a longer contract length to reflect international standards. Huawei Digital Power and Cambodian renewable energy developer SchneiTec have commissioned the country's first TÜV SÜD-certified grid-forming energy storage system (ESS), marking a milestone in Cambodia's shift toward more resilient, renewable-based power. In September 2024, the Cambodian Council of Ministers approved 23 power sector investment projects, totaling $5. 79 billion, for implementation between 2024 and 2029. These initiatives include 12 solar power plants, six wind farms, a combined biomass and solar facility, an LNG power generation.
